摘要: 公钥密码体制中多数公开审计方案存在证书管理问题,会增加存储负荷和通信成本。为有效验证半可信云中数据的完整性,减少证书管理的额外开销,提出一种无证书的公开审计方案。采用同态技术实现批审计,高效完成多个用户的审计需求,通过ELGamal加密体制对用户身份进行追踪,防止用户的恶意行为。安全性和性能分析结果表明,该方案安全高效,能够抵抗类型Ⅰ和类型Ⅱ敌手攻击,并满足签名不可伪造性和签名用户身份隐私性。

Abstract: Many public audit schemes in public key cryptosystem have certificate management problem,which will increase storage load and communication cost.In order to effectively verify the integrity of the data in the semi-trusted cloud and reduce the extra cost of certificate management,this paper proposes a certificateless public audit scheme.The batch audit is realized by using homomorphic technology,so as to efficiently complete the audit needs of multiple users.The ELGamal encryption system is adopted to track user identity,thus preventing the malicious behavior of users.The results of security and performance analysis show that the proposed scheme is safe and efficient.It can resist typeⅠand typeⅡadversary attacks and satisfy the unforgeability of signature and the privacy of user identity.
